Wynnchurch Capital to Acquire Luxfer Holdings PLC
in Take-Private Transaction
Rosemont, IL – July 27, 2026 – Wynnchurch Capital, L.P. (“Wynnchurch”) and Luxfer Holdings PLC (NYSE: LXFR) (“Luxfer” or the “Company”) today announced that they have entered into a definitive agreement under which an affiliate of Wynnchurch will acquire Luxfer in an all-cash transaction. Upon completion of the transaction, Luxfer will become a privately held company.
Luxfer is a global manufacturer of highly engineered advanced materials and components serving aerospace, defense and other mission-critical end markets. The Company operates through two market-leading segments, Elektron and Gas Cylinders, and maintains longstanding relationships with a diversified, blue-chip customer base.

The transaction is currently expected to be completed prior to the end of 2026, subject to approval of Luxfer shareholders, receipt of regulatory approvals and customary closing conditions.
Lazard is acting as financial advisor to Wynnchurch, and Kirkland & Ellis LLP is acting as legal advisor to Wynnchurch. Deutsche Bank Securities Inc. is acting as exclusive financial advisor to Luxfer, and Fried, Frank, Harris, Shriver & Jacobson LLP is acting as legal advisor to Luxfer.
About Luxfer:
Luxfer is a global industrial company innovating niche applications in materials engineering. Using its broad array of proprietary technologies, Luxfer focuses on value creation, customer satisfaction, and demanding applications where technical know-how and manufacturing expertise combine to deliver a superior product. Luxfer’s high-performance materials, components, and high-pressure gas containment devices are used in defense and emergency response, clean energy, healthcare, transportation, and specialty industrial applications. About Wynnchurch Capital:
Wynnchurch Capital, L.P. is a leading middle-market private equity investment firm that has been investing in industrial businesses for more than 25 years. Wynnchurch is currently investing out of its sixth private equity fund and manages approximately $9.1 billion of assets under management. The firm’s strategy is to partner with middle-market companies that possess the potential for substantial growth and profit improvement. Wynnchurch specializes in recapitalizations, growth capital, management buyouts, corporate carve-outs, and restructurings. Recent exits include the pending sale of FloWorks to Ferguson Enterprises Inc. (NYSE: FERG) in a transaction valued at approximately $1.6 billion and sale of Labrie Environmental Group to Hiab Corporation (Nasdaq Helsinki: HIAB) in a transaction valued at approximately $1.035 billion. Recent investments include MSHS Pacific Power Group, Sterno, NABRICO Marine Products, Charter Industries, and Astro Shapes.
